About The Author
Mary O’Loughlin Starkweather
Mary Starkweather was born Mary O’Loughlin. Growing up in a family of eight, she was always surrounded by shared experiences and storytelling that gave rise to her love for words. In the early 2000s, her journey took her to Colorado, where aspens towered, winding trails and crisp mountain air became the center of her poetry and stories.
Mary works part-time in the school and always finds inspiration in her daily walks in nature. The landscapes she wrote – the mountains kissed by the sun or the flowering streams – became the center of her work, resulting in In Sight of the Aspen Grove.
